I doubt anyone who does know the answer to your question would answer. it would be devistating if you rationalized running away. the streets are brutal to young people. you have other resources. if you are being abused, tell an adult that you do trust. talk to a social worker, councilor, a member of a nearby church. there are lots of people who live just to help people like you. whatever is going on... you can work through it.
